I admit that the prompt #ByKristinHannah for #52books was one I anticipated the least. Perhaps even dreaded it. I never really had interest in her books and maybe even read one bad review that subconsciously stuck with me. BUT after seeing numerous people rave that this was a favorite (especially you @aperfectmjk ) I decided to put a hold on The Nightingale and it was one of the better books I read this year. ⬇️

Kelly_the_Bookish_Sidekick We follow two sisters whose lives diverge during the German occupation of France in WWII. Both women experience love & loss and fight the Nazis in their own way. I was intrigued with the audiobook the entire way through.
